  • Sean came to replace a fuel Pump (that we provided). He gave me a quot... read more Sean came to replace a fuel Pump (that we provided). He gave me a quote of $330 and 3hr job. After a couple hrs. he came to me and said he couldn't get the ring off even after buying a specialty part. He then told me he had to buy a new ring. Two weeks later he came back and after I think another 3 hrs. he charged me $169. He then said you have an exhaust leak to which I said I know. Then he said "It would've been nice to know it had a full tank of gas". Does he think since he was here the first time I went and filled it? A few days later we took to get the exhaust leak when they put it up on the rack they said "did someone work on this recently?" They showed me he didn't bolt on on of the tank straps, left 2 hoses unconnected and the ring was all buggered up and had a hole gas was leaking out. So it was clear to me he put on the old ring. When I called him he said "we can cover it under warranty and said " I put it on hand tight and I have video of it." I said I was under the van and had pictures which I sent him. He set an appt for Dec 23 haven't seen or heard him since. He seems like nice guy but I would never trust him to touch my cars ever again.

  • Sam is awesome to work with. He has done all of the major services or... read more Sam is awesome to work with. He has done all of the major services or repairs on my Audi A6. They always seem to be able to get me in on short notice and complete the work on time or ahead of schedule. I have had no issues with any of the repairs or maintenance services they have provided. True story: They replaced my brakes with some after market brakes that were supposed to be awesome. However, after a week or so the brakes started to squeal. I called Sam and told him the problem. His response was, "bring the car in immediately and we'll swap out the brakes for OEM brakes. We can't have you driving your Audi with squeaky brakes." I took the car in, they swapped out the brakes the same day and didn't charge me a dime. Awesome customer service. I recently was in the market to purchase another Audi and before doing so had Sam check it out to see if there were any major problems. In 5 minutes he was able to let me know that the previous owner hadn't run synthetic oil and that a gasket was leaking. He saved me from buying a "problem" car. Oh, and he didn't charge me anything for it. These guys know European cars and treat their clients very well. They are much cheaper than the dealership and an absolute pleasure to do business with. Their new shop in Pleasant Grove is much nicer and easier to find. David P Highland UT
